Jump to content

zmena ID pri zmene nazvu kuriera


Maria_M
 Share

Recommended Posts

Caute

chcem sa opytat ci je to OK ze sa zmeni ID (vid. priloha) ked napr. prepisem meno kuriera ?
Nie je potom poroblem s Ship2Pay ak je naviazny na nejakeho kuriera s ID 2 a ked sa mu zmeni meno alebo popis tak ten kurier ma ID 3 ?
Nemalo by ID pri zmene ostat stale rovnake ?

Maria

PS: robi to verzia 1.3 aj 1.4

41675_uRXtxt7C3XovaRE8P8PI_t

Share this post


Link to post
Share on other sites

Zmena ID dopravcu (zneplatnenie stareho a vytvorenie dalsieho s novym ID) pri editacii je zamer, predpokladam aby nebolo mozne pri existujucich objednavkach zmenit zakaznikom zvoleneho dopravcu (niekto zvoli osobny odber, v tabulke objednavky ma zadane ID dopravcu a ty mu to zmenis na kuriera). Nie je to moc stastne riesenie, chcelo by to v BO nejaky checkbox, kde by sa dalo zvolit, ci editaciou vytvorit novy zaznam dopravcu alebo len UPDATE, hlavne ked sa jedná len o doplnenie popisu.

Ja som upravy popisov dopravcov (aj vacsinu lang tabuliek) riesil priamym zapisom do tabuliek (prefix_carrier*) v databaze. Moj tip na na editaciu tabuliek okrem phpMyAdmin je Adminer. Pre PS staci stiahnut Adminer pre MySQL (je to jeden php skript), nahrat ho na server do "tajneho" adresara a spustit v prehliadaci. Vypyta si konfiguracne udaje /server,databaza,meno,heslo/ a ide sa na vec ... vid obr.

Pri priemernej znalosti MySQL a struktury PS tabuliek je to vacsia zabava ako preklikavat zalozky v BO.
Zalohovanie DB pred upravami je doporucovane ;)

41714_mJ3CLD2VkeueDKeISuqy_t

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
 Share

×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More